AUTHORITIES

Define your concept of authorities

A person who makes decisions for others. To have authority is be able to make people do things for you. For example a teacher who gives homework. A judge or an employer who has authority over her/his employees.

Police:

Personal experience: a guy rides his bike at Amarbrogade in Copenhagen. He’s got no lights on the bike. A police car pulls over on the other side of the road. The man on the bike stops. He dismounts and pulls his bike to the car, knocks on the window and says. I’m sorry, i haven’t got any lights on. How much is the fine? To which the officer answers that’s alright. As long as you pull your bike the rest of the way. The man thanks the officer. Pulls his bike for about 200 m. locks it and goes to his destination point. The moral: he’s 200 m from home, but instead of going for it, trying to "cheat" the officer-whom, by the way, didn’t even stop him-he stops to pay a 500kr fine.

Many people in our country have a lot of respect for the Danish police force because we have been raised by our parents to respect them. The police have the power to arrest you and even worse to put something on your record.
